The Sharing of Blessings Foundation

GRAND HAVEN, MI EIN: 20-1864617

The Sharing of Blessings Foundation is a private foundation focused on Philanthropy, Voluntarism & Grantmaking, based in GRAND HAVEN, MI. IRS filing data is available from 2020 through 2024. As of 2024, the organization holds $2.2M in total assets. In 2024, it awarded 50 grants totaling $123K. Net investment income was $74K.

Under IRS private-foundation payout rules, The Sharing of Blessings Foundation reported a distributable amount of $111K for 2024 — the minimum it must pay out in qualifying distributions.
